Does Skyrim have dragons in it?

Dragons (drah-gkon and dov-rha to the ancient Nords, or dov in their native language) are large flying reptilian creatures that are encountered in Skyrim.

Can you play Skyrim without killing dragons?

No it's not. You have to kill at least two dragons in the game to finish the main questline. You have to kill the one at the watchtower outside of whiterun for a quest, and then at the end you must slay alduin.

Can Skyrim dragons reproduce?

They do not mate or breed. There are no known examples of dragon eggs or dragonlings.

What does killing dragons do in Skyrim?

When slain, these humongous creatures allow you to harvest their scales and bones to craft powerful Dragon Armor (which comes in both light and heavy flavors). The heavy version of Dragon armor only requires dragon bones, dragon scales, and some leather.

Why can't you control a dragon in Skyrim?

In order to ride a dragon, you must acquire all three words of the Bend Will shout and use it on a dragon. The dragon will then land and allow you to climb onto its back and ride it. You cannot directly control the dragon while riding, but can give it certain instructions.

Do dragons get harder in Skyrim?

Around level 40 these cunning dragons will begin to appear and are significantly harder to defeat than the regular Frost or Fire dragons. Elder Dragons are able to harness both elements at the same time, making them particularly hard to counter with spells.
